‘A Christmas Mix’ Concert – POSTPONED

Unfortunately this fundraising concert has had to be cancelled for now due to a significant outbreak of COVID-19 among the Chorus. It’s hoped to reschedule it at the same venue early in the new year.  ***WATCH THIS SPACE!*** Previous info… This is a charity concert by St Peter’s Church and Grand Central Chorus in aid of The Ruddington Pantry. ‘A Christmas Mix’ is at 8pm on Wednesday 6th December inside the Church. Organisers have laid on about an hour of Christmas songs from the Shows and Pop Classics. You can expect…

Platinum Jubilee Plans Progress

A provisional programme of events has been revealed for Ruddington’s celebrations of Her Majesty the Queen’s seventy years on the throne this summer. With extra UK public holidays already in place for the Platinum Jubilee, Ruddington Parish Council has organised a weekend of activities to mark our much loved Monarch’s record breaking reign. From Thursday 2nd until Sunday 5th June 2022, The Green will be home to beacon lighting, a tree-planting ceremony and a community picnic, followed by games and live music, for all to enjoy.
